A court in the Perm region fined the parents of a schoolboy who was found to be a troublemaker.

As the regional court explained , during the trial it emerged that the 11-year-old attacker had insulted the fifth-grader and had also struck her several times on the head and legs.

The court upheld the claims and awarded 35,000 rubles to the parents of the guilty boy for failing to instill respect in their child. Additionally, 15,000 rubles were awarded in compensation for moral damages from the educational institution for failing to provide adequate supervision of its students.
